Estimation of articulation angle for tractor semi-trailer with 3 axles based on extended Kalman filter

CHU Liang,FANG Yong,GUO Jian-hua,SHANG Ming-li,ZHOU Fei-kun   

  1. State Key Laboratory of Automobile Dynamic Simulation,Jilin University,Changchun 130022,China
  • Received:2010-01-04 Online:2010-09-01 Published:2010-09-01

Abstract:

An estimator is designed to estimate the articulation angle based on extended Kalman filter(EFK), where a 3 DOF tractor semitrailer vehicle model and nonlinear tire lateral force is employed, and the signals from sensors of electronic stability control (ESC) system for commercial vehicle are used. The estimator is validated on a 21 DOF nonlinear vehicle model and the results show that the articulation angle can be estimated accurately in both linear and nonlinear area of tire lateral force.

Key words: vehicle engineering;tractor semi-trailer, jackknife, extended Kalman filter, articulation angle, vehicle model
